Braswell House is dedicated to helping anyone with an alcohol or drug abuse issue in the East Dublin, Georgia area find complete recovery. It provides several services - such as inpatient drug rehab centers, long term addiction treatment facilities, outpatient detoxification centers, intensive outpatient treatment, short term addiction treatment programs and others - in line with its philosophy of the addiction treatment and rehab methods that are effective in recovery. This drug and alcohol treatment facility also believes that people require individual care to be able to stop abusing drugs and alcohol.
As such, Braswell House has specialized in anger management, brief intervention approach, group therapy, motivational interviewing, vocational rehabilitation services, rational emotive behavioral therapy and more. At the same time, it accepts patients who are persons who have experienced sexual abuse, residential beds for client's children, persons with post-traumatic stress disorder, persons with serious mental illness, seniors or older adults, active duty military, and others. This substance abuse treatment center uses treatment modalities that can help clients to achieve lasting and permanent sobriety from the substances of abuse that they have used in the past.
In terms of payment, clients in Braswell House can pay for services using private insurance, cash or self-payment, sliding fee scale, medicare, medicaid, state education funds, county or local government funds and others.
